A4E, I agree with you for one of the few times, I suspect. Saban had no draft to speak of this off season. Thanks to the previous regime. How can you improve ? The competition had a "double draft " and are already programed for another one this next off season. His opposition is in fine cap shape and can buy players or trade for them to fill the few holes they might develop. The Patriots have added eight newcomers draftees or UDFAs, to their roster and traded for Gabriel and signed Caldwell, Seau, Jones and Gardner. Now they have lost two of them to IR, but they still improved and these guys will be back next season, meaning Nick has to do much better to just stand in place. The team he inherited from Wanny is aging rapidly. Before he can rebuild the O-line and the secondary, the D line will go over the hill and his best LBs too. Nick needs a big shovel to dig before he gets swamped. |
